Try this recipe for terrific chocolate chip cookies!

Preparation Time
15 mins
Cooking Time
15 mins
Total Time
30 mins
Calories
267 Calories

Recipe Instructions

Step 1
Divide the dough into 24 3-tablespoon-sized balls. Flatten the balls to about 1/4-inch thick onto a baking sheet.
Step 2
Bake in the preheated oven until the edges are golden, 15 to 17 minutes. Allow the cookies to cool on the baking sheet until the centers begin to set, about 20 minutes.
Step 3
Gather all ingredients. Preheat an oven to 300 degrees F (150 degrees C).
Step 4
Gently mix the flour, baking powder, baking soda, and salt with a fork in a bowl.
Step 5
Beat the butter, brown sugar, and white sugar with an electric mixer in a large bowl until smooth. Add the eggs one at a time, allowing each egg to blend into the butter mixture before adding the next. Beat in the vanilla with the last egg.
Step 6
Mix in the flour mixture until just incorporated. Fold in the chocolate chips; mixing just enough to evenly combine.

Ingredients

  • 2 eggs
  • 1 teaspoon baking soda
  • 1 cup butter, softened
  • 1 teaspoon baking powder
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 6 tablespoons white sugar
  • 4 teaspoons vanilla extract
  • 2 cups brown sugar
  • 1 (12 ounce) bag chocolate chips
  • 3.5 cups all-purpose flour
